TITLE: Manager, Data & Reporting
LOCATION: St. Louis, MO

JOB SUMMARY: Oversee and administer multiple reporting applications and liaison with Charter's application IT teams for support needs. Responsible for database development for specific reporting needs and utilize multiple database languages and structures. Monitor backend application resource allocation and performance. Develop technical designs for projects. Train team on technical processes. Develop and maintain security roles and groups for user application access. Communicate with IT support teams on any issues impacting front-end applications. Define and document requirements for new processes and reports. Build attributes, metrics, and structures needed for final reports. Connect front-end applications and back-end database systems. Troubleshoot system errors from front end applications and backend systems. Develop new database objects, jobs, and procedures in SQL, Oracle, and HANA. Document all database and report application changes for audit purposes. Code in SQL for SQL server and Oracle databases. Build reports and dashboards in Business Objects. Use and build SAP HANA database. Build report in a reporting system including Tableau, MicroStrategy, Business Objects, or Power BI. Perform MicroStrategy administration including creating and managing users, security groups, subscriptions, schedules, projects, and database instances. Maintain processes for ticketing, change documentation, user validation and approval capture, and separation of duties management utilizing SOX compliance practices. Perform unit testing of the reports developed. Develop and review free form SQL queries to develop the reports and extra the necessary data to address customer business needs. Design and architect MicroStrategy schema objects such as facts, attributes, and hierarchies that support customer requirements. Analyze SQL queries and translate them into MicroStrategy visualizations and reports. Assist in functional and systems testing of integrated reporting applications, dashboards, and KPIs. Develop required documentation in support of the development lifecycle. Organize schema and public objects, attributes, metrics, and reports for ease of use.

EDUCATION/REQUIREMENTS: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Information Systems, or a related field. 3 years of experience: building reports in a reporting system including any combination of the following: Tableau, MicroStrategy, Business Objects, or Power BI; and coding in SQL for SQL server and Oracle databases. 2 years of experience in: MicroStrategy administration including creating and managing users, security groups, subscriptions, schedules, projects, and database instances; building reports and dashboards in Business Objects; and maintaining processes for ticketing, change documentation, user validation and approval capture, and separation of duties management utilizing SOX compliance practices. 1 year of experience using and building SAP HANA database. A hybrid (in office and remote work) arrangement is available.
